## Formula sandbox tuning

User-supplied formulas in Gridmoor execute inside a restricted interpreter with hard ceilings on time, memory, and call depth. Reviewers should confirm any change to these ceilings is justified in the PR description, since raising them widens the abuse surface. Defaults were chosen from production traces. The current limits are as follows.

limits module of tafog-fawip:
WEIGHTS = {
    "julix": 57,
    "lamys": 992,
    "kasvan": 209,
    "quenok": 750,
    "alddor": 259,
    "oliath": 1009,
    "wenix": 815,
}

# Client setup for Sproutline, the plant-watering scheduler service.
# Schedules are pulled hourly from the Greenhaven zone registry;
# watering commands are idempotent, so duplicate dispatches are safe.
# Do not raise the poll rate — valve controllers throttle hard at 10 rpm.
# The scheduler endpoint requires service auth. Its key follows below.

gateway credential: kto23_LX9A4ys6i4nzHtpOLNLodKK

## Sharding the Profile Store (Runbook excerpt)

Heads up for the security review: we're splitting the Larkfield profile store into eight shards, keyed on hashed account handle. No PII leaves the Verano region during rebalance, and the shard router runs with the same mTLS posture as before. Rollback is a single flag flip. The values the router loads at boot are listed below.

config for haweg-bagag:
[kasath]
host = kasath.qirvancorp.internal
user = kasath_svc
database = kasath_prod

## Step 4: Update your reader bindings

If your plugin talks to the Chirptrack timing-chip reader, heads up: the polling API is gone. Readers now push split times over the event bus, so drop any `pollReader` calls and subscribe to the `chip.read` topic instead. Antenna gain and debounce settings moved out of plugin code into the host config, which keeps race-day tweaks sane. The host expects these values.

config for hahop-kageg:
[gorox]
host = gorox.braskio.corp
user = gorox_svc
database = gorox_prod